e-Learning in Phoniatrics and Speech-Language Pathology: Exploratory Analysis of Free Access Tools in Augmentative
Jessica Büchs1, Christiane Neuschaefer-Rube1
1Clinic for Phoniatrics, Pedaudiology & Communication Disorders, University Hospital and Medical Faculty, RWTH Aachen University, Pauwelsstraße 30, Aachen, 52074, Germany, 49 2418038717.
This study explored free augmentative and alternative communication (AAC) e-learning tools for speech-language pathology professionals. Findings reveal variations in formats, content, and learning styles across basic and advanced levels, highlighting a need for further research.
Area of Science:
- Speech-Language Pathology
- Assistive Technology
- Medical Education
Background:
- Augmentative and alternative communication (AAC) is crucial for individuals with limited or no expressive language.
- Speech-language pathologists and phoniatricians require expertise in AAC to manage complex communication needs.
- While numerous e-learning resources exist for AAC knowledge acquisition, their attributes remain under-investigated.
Purpose of the Study:
- To explore freely accessible AAC e-learning tools relevant to speech-language pathology students and professionals.
- To analyze the formats, content areas, learning styles, and learning goals of these AAC e-learning tools.
- To investigate structural differences in AAC e-learning tools between basic and advanced learner levels.
Main Methods:
- A systematic web-based search was conducted in 2023 across multiple databases and app stores, adhering to PRISMA guidelines.
- Inclusion criteria focused on free access, mandatory AAC content, and English/German language, excluding social media and video-sharing platforms.
- Analysis encompassed tool formats, content areas (type, diagnostics, therapy), learning styles (visual, auditory, audio-visual), and learning goals (receptive, performative) for basic and advanced levels.
Main Results:
- 131 free AAC e-learning tools were identified: 57 basic (43.5%) and 74 advanced (56.5%). Websites constituted the majority (80.2%), followed by online courses (16%).
- Advanced tools more frequently covered diagnostics (87.8%) and therapy (86.5%) compared to basic tools. Performative tasks were rare, especially in basic level tools (0% vs. 16.2% in advanced).
- Most tools utilized a "visual (text)" learning style (100% basic, 89.2% advanced). Advanced tools were more likely online courses (25.7% vs. 3.5%) and featured more audio-visual content (36.5% vs. 8.8%).
Conclusions:
- Free AAC e-learning resources for speech-language pathology exhibit considerable variation in format, content, and learning styles.
- Significant differences exist between basic and advanced learner-level tools, particularly in content focus and the availability of performative tasks.
- This study provides a foundational analysis for future research and development in AAC e-learning, aiming to enhance professional competency.
